Climate change protesters caused traffic chaos this morning as they parked a car across the Heathrow tunnel in protest of the proposed third runway.

A blue Volkswagen was draped in a banner reading ‘No new runways’. The protest began just before 8.30am.

Initially three cars had been parked across the tunnel, with three protesters locked inside one of them.

The drivers of two of the vehicles have been arrested for obstructing a highway.

Officers are still trying to remove the protesters locked in one of the cars.


The M4 approaching terminals 2 and 3 was completely gridlocked, with images emerging on Twitter of cars lining as far as the eye can see.

Transport for London Traffic News tweeted: “The Heathrow Tunnel (into the airport) is currently blocked due to in impromptu demonstration, traffic is slow on M4 Spur”


Metropolitan Police said: "A contra-flow is in place in the outbound tunnel to facilitate the movement of traffic around the blocked tunnel (which is now empty), but motorists are advised possible delays to their journey as this incident is dealt with."
